ATI revenues rise on PC card sales
Graphics card and chip maker ATI on Tuesday reported the results for the first quarter of its fiscal year 2005, which ended November 30, 2004. The company reported revenues of $613.9 million, a 30.7 percent increase for the same quarter a year ago.
